City of Culver City, California City Council Agenda Item Report RECOMMENDATION: Staff recommends that the City Council approve the final plans and specifications and authorize advertising for construction bids for the Krueger and Lindblade Streets Streetlight Improvement Projects, P-652 and P-684. BACKGROUND: This year’s Capital Improvement Budget includes Krueger and Lindblade Streets Streetlight Improvement Project, P-652 and P-684. The existing streetlight system on Krueger Street between Ince Boulevard and its northerly terminus and Lindblade Street between Higuera Street and its northerly terminus was identified as substandard and requires replacement and upgrade. The existing streetlight system has become obsolete and requires replacement for several reasons:  It is on series circuit and is over 30 years old;  It has lead wiring which tends to corrode;  It runs on high voltage; and,  It does not provide an adequate level of illumination. The new system will address these issues. DISCUSSION: The scope of work along Krueger Street consists of the removal and replacement of the existing streetlights with one (1) 25-foot-high ‘Cobra-head’ streetlight at the street terminus; and fourteen (14) 11-foot-high traditional marberlite standards with ‘acorn’ lamps. The scope of work along Lindblade Street consists of the removal and replacement of existing streetlights with six (6) 25-foot-high fluted-steel standards. The new lights will be on parallel circuitry and spaced such that an appropriate level of illumination is provided. On June 1, 2005 an invitation was sent to the residents of Krueger Street, between Ince Boulevard and its northerly terminus; and businesses along Lindblade Street, between Higuera Street and its northerly terminus, for a community meeting that was held on June 8, 2005, 7 p.m. at the Veterans’ Memorial Complex. The purpose of the meeting was to discuss the proposed streetlight improvement project and provide a forum for the residents to review and comment on the design plans. No residents or business owners/representatives attended the meeting. Under Engineering Division staff supervision, Paller-Roberts Engineering, Inc. prepared the construction plans and specifications for this project for $19,200. It is proposed that the two projects be combined as one for bidding and construction purposes. Costs such as mobilization and buying streetlights in bulk will reduce the overall bid. The construction management and construction inspection will be performed by Engineering Division staff.
